Bird control is a general term for the removal and/or prevention of feral birds, usually from buildings or other unwanted locations. The type of method undertaken will vary depending on the specific bird or the location of the device.
Before removing any birds from a site it is important to understand the latest UK regulations as all birds by law are protected. Some birds such as pigeons have specific general licences that are available for their control if they fall within specific categories such as health and safety. Prevention of birds before they establish is always the recommended and best approach. In the UK we have several products that are suitable for prevention of birds including netting and bird spikes.
When suitable the installation of physical barriers such as netting or mesh is the recommended solution to stop birds and they can be used in a wide range of scenarios including when birds are nesting. Other products such as spikes and post-wire systems act as a device to prevent birds from landing but may not be suitable for where birds are nesting.
